Key Features
- High-speed DSP processingDrastically reduces lag and improves engraving speed for complex designs.
- 4.3-inch TFT Color DisplayProvides an intuitive, easy-to-read interface for real-time adjustments without needing a PC.
- Advanced Path PlanningOptimizes laser movement to reduce vibration and improve edge quality on intricate cuts.
- Multi-interface supportOffers USB, Ethernet, and U-disk connectivity for flexible file transfer methods.
- Real-time power controlAllows for precise modulation of laser intensity during the cutting process for cleaner finishes.
- Multi-language supportMakes the system accessible and easy to configure for global users.
